Js perlin noise. In this new multi-part Perlin Noise Tuto...
Js perlin noise. In this new multi-part Perlin Noise Tutorial, I show you what Perlin noise is and how it can be used in creative coding, more specifically with the p5. js has a function called noise (), which generates these smooth gradients using a function called Perlin noise, named after its inventor, Ken In this new multi-part Perlin Noise Tutorial, I show you what Perlin noise is and how it can be used in creative coding, more specifically with the p5. Contribute to leodeslf/perlin-noise development by creating an account on GitHub. - wwwtyro/perlin. We’ll break down the math, provide working code examples, and highlight common // TOOLZ // PERLIN AND SIMPLEX NOISES // From: https://github. Before delving into the steps to generate Perlin noise, let's Ken Perlin invented noise() while animating the original Tron film in the 1980s. In Part I. Procedural Noise-Based Deformation a) Uses Perlin Noise (ImprovedNoise) to create smooth, natural surface distortion. One can use it for the creation of clouds, terrain or the Perlin noise can be used to simulate natural, flowing gradients such as terrain, water or smoke. Javascript 2D Perlin & Simplex noise functions. js. 2 of this series, I introduce you to Javascript perlin's noise implementation - Demo on the arcanis/voxplode repository - arcanis/js. js There’s a decent implementation in P5. Latest version: 2. 🏔 A Perlin Noise library for JavaScript. The input to the Perlin noise function is a three-dimensional point that “travels” across the noise landscape. It also adds the parameters to the URL, so that it can be shared. I want it without A JavaScript library for Perlin Noise generation. js I'm trying to create a perlin / simplex / value noise function in JavaScript that will give results similar to the following: (Note: this image has already had a treshold applied. js lib The Perlin noise generator in p5js is a fantastic feature that allows us to code up a plethora of different sketches, here's a rundown of how it works as well as some In this new multi-part Perlin Noise Tutorial, I show you what Perlin noise is and how it can be used in creative coding, more specifically with the p5. 0, last published: 12 years ago. The library is pretty fast (10M queries / sec). Noise is pretty. Well, I consider this an hommage to Ken Perlin. noise() always returns values between 0 and 1. two Perlin noise generators in javascript. I’ve made many small artistic online sketches making use of Perlin Noise: it’s very natural noise, it NOISE! This is a simple library for 2d & 3d perlin noise and simplex noise in javascript. Contribute to josephg/noisejs development by creating an account on GitHub. com/josephg/noisejs /* * A speed-improved perlin and simplex I’ve made many small artistic online sketches making use of Perlin Noise: it’s very natural noise, it isn’t bumpy like Math. Perlin noise can be used to simulate natural, flowing gradients such as terrain, water or smoke. It returns the same value for a For this reason, p5. Perlin noise implementation. Before delving into the steps to generate Perlin noise, let's Library-free Perlin noise derived from p5. Contribute to chriscourses/perlin-noise development by creating an account on GitHub. This guide will walk you through creating 2D Perlin Noise and 2D Simplex Noise functions in JavaScript. random(), it’s smooth. GitHub Gist: instantly share code, notes, and snippets. Compute Perlin noise. Perlin noise implementation in Javascript. Contribute to joeiddon/perlin development by creating an account on GitHub. A javascript 1, 2, and 3-dimensional perlin noise generator. js library. There are 27 other projects in the npm registry using noisejs. perlin For this reason, p5. JavaScript library for graphical objects. js Noise Perlin noise is an algorithm written by Ken Perlin to produce sequences that appear both random and organic. b) Combines noise with real-time audio data for droplet-style fluid In this new multi-part Perlin Noise Tutorial, I show you what Perlin noise is and how it can be used in creative coding, more specifically with the p5. The simplex version is about 10% faster (in Chrome at least, haven't tried other browsers) - perlin-noise-classical. Start using noisejs in your project by running `npm i noisejs`. js has a function called noise (), which generates these smooth gradients using a function called Perlin noise, named after its inventor, Ken The app allows you to tweak every parameter involved in noise calculation and rendering and to save the resulting texture. 1. The input to the Perlin noise function is a . Creating Perlin Noise in JS Perlin noise is a type of random, yet smooth, noise that can be easily generated using a particular algorithm. But its still way slower than using a shader. The noise () function in 3. zw06, 4t72k, gswsk, 0nure, ego1, kr47y, 3byhq, j4jrk, j0p1, iiiwb,